#183ffa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#183ffa is composed of 9.4% red, 24.7% green and 98%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.4% cyan, 74.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 229.6 degrees, a saturation of 95.8% and a lightness of 53.7%. #183ffa color hex could be obtained by blending #307eff with #0000f5. Closest websafe color is: #0033ff.

Shades and Tints of #183ffa

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000413 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#183ffa

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#85868d is the less saturated color, while #183ffa is the most saturated one.
